How Do Smart Sprinklers Actually Work?

Soil moisture sensor inserted into Northeast Indiana garden bed showing real-time water measurement technology for smart irrigation systems

Smart sprinkler systems use weather intelligence and soil sensors to deliver water exactly when your Fort Wayne lawn needs it. Connected to your smartphone via an app, these controllers receive local weather forecasts and automatically skip watering on rainy days or when temperatures drop. Some models include soil moisture sensors that measure ground water content in real time, preventing overwatering and promoting deeper root growth.

Unlike standard timer-based systems that water on a fixed schedule regardless of conditions, smart controllers adapt to Northeast Indiana's unpredictable spring and summer weather. If rain is forecast for tomorrow, the system delays watering. During cool periods or after heavy rainfall, it reduces cycle frequency. This responsive approach means your lawn gets consistent hydration without waste.

What Water and Money Savings Can You Expect?

Water meter monitored for smart sprinkler savings on Fort Wayne property showing reduced water consumption and cost benefits

Homeowners across Fort Wayne typically see water savings between 30-50% after installing smart irrigation systems. For a property using 100,000-150,000 gallons annually, that translates to real dollar savings on your water bill—often $20-50 per month depending on your municipal rates and lawn size. Over a season, many Northeast Indiana homeowners recover their system investment through utility savings alone.

Beyond direct water bill reductions, smart systems lower your overall property maintenance costs. Less water consumption means less fertilizer runoff, reducing chemical treatment needs. Are Smart Sprinklers Reliable in Fort Wayne's Climate?

Northeast Indiana's USDA Zone 5b climate—with clay-heavy soil, variable spring weather, and hot summers—is ideal for smart irrigation. Fort Wayne experiences an average of 40-50 inches of rainfall annually, distributed unevenly across seasons. Smart controllers excel in this environment by compensating for dry spells and preventing overwatering during wet periods.

The region's clay soil retains moisture longer than sandy soils, which means smart sensors provide especially valuable data. They prevent the root rot and fungal issues that develop when clay soil stays saturated. During Northeast Indiana's typical dry August and September, smart systems adjust upward to maintain turf health through dormancy season.

  • Weather-based controllers skip watering during Fort Wayne's spring rain showers
  • Soil sensors prevent overwatering in clay-heavy Northeast Indiana soil
  • Mobile apps let you adjust settings from anywhere during travel or emergencies
  • Seasonal programming prepares your lawn for dormancy in late fall
  • Smart controllers integrate with existing sprinkler zones and equipment

What Features Matter Most for Your Fort Wayne Lawn?

The best smart sprinkler system for your property depends on your lawn size, existing irrigation setup, and technology comfort level. Weather-based controllers are ideal for most Fort Wayne homeowners—they're affordable ($100-300) and work with any existing sprinkler system. Soil moisture sensor systems cost more ($300-800) but provide the most precise watering, especially valuable for larger properties in Northeast Indiana.

Key Features to Prioritize

  • Local weather integration – Ensure the system accesses Fort Wayne or your specific Northeast Indiana zip code's forecast data
  • User-friendly mobile app – You should easily adjust schedules, view water usage, and pause watering from your phone
  • Zone flexibility – Different areas of your lawn may need different watering (sun vs. shade, clay vs. amended soil)
  • Seasonal adjustment – Systems should automatically reduce watering as temperatures drop in Northeast Indiana fall
  • Water usage reports – Track savings and identify any system leaks or malfunctions

Can You Install Smart Sprinklers With Your Existing System?

Yes—most smart irrigation controllers retrofit existing Fort Wayne sprinkler systems without replacement. Weather-based controllers simply replace your old timer in the controller box, typically a 30-minute DIY job or a professional installation for under $200. If your system lacks a controller entirely, a licensed irrigation specialist in Northeast Indiana can add one during the spring startup season.

What About Smart Sprinkler Maintenance and Support?

Smart irrigation systems require minimal ongoing maintenance—typically just spring startup and fall winterization of your Fort Wayne sprinkler lines. The digital controller itself has no moving parts to wear out. Most systems receive free software updates that improve weather accuracy and add features. Customer support from major manufacturers is responsive and available 24/7 through app chat or phone.

Northeast Indiana winters require proper system shutdown to prevent frozen pipes. Schedule winterization before the first hard freeze—usually late October in Fort Wayne. Spring startup (typically mid-April) is the ideal time to verify your smart controller's settings and adjust zones for the growing season.
